Mississippi PERS Stability Act; create.
HB 1509, the "Mississippi PERS Stability Act," would have transferred $500 million from Mississippi's Capital Expense Fund to the Public Employees' Retirement System (PERS) on July 1, 2026, followed by annual $50 million transfers through July 1, 2036. These funds would directly support state public employees' retirement benefits by strengthening PERS' financial stability. The bill required using General Funds if the Capital Expense Fund lacked sufficient unobligated funds for the annual transfers. The bill was referred to committees but died in committee on February 3, 2026, and did not become law.
